Tuesday's North and South action review

By David Watters

Shaw Lane AFC returned to the top of the EVO-STIK Northern Premier League's First Division South table on Tuesday night after an emphatic 6-0 win at Ashby Avenue against Lincoln United, writes Pitchero's Steve Whitney.

A brace of Ryan Qualter headers after seven and 16 minutes had the high-flying visitors firmly in command. Seven minutes into the second half, Gavin Allott made it 3-0. United had a chance to get back into the game soon afterwards, but Danny Brooks missed from the penalty spot.

He was punished further just before the hour-mark when Gary Burnett added Shaw Lane`s fourth and, despite the home side having two efforts cleared off the line, the visitors wrapped up a convincing win with a second for Allott after 64 minutes and then Spencer Harris five minutes later.

The only game in the First Division North on Tuesday saw Ramsbottom United remain a point in front of Droylsden in mid-table after the sides shared a 1-1 Butcher`s Arms draw.

Rammy led through Grant Spencer`s goal eight minutes before the break. But Jamie Frost`s penalty 20 minutes from time salvaged a draw for the Bloods.
